Position Purpose of a Domestic Cleaner at Focused Care:
- ·Carry out regular household cleaning tasks including vacuuming, sweeping, mopping, dusting, and sanitising surfaces.
- ·Maintain high standards of cleanliness in kitchens, bathrooms, and living areas.
- ·Assist with laundry duties such as washing, hanging, folding, ironing, and putting away clothing and linen.
- ·Change bedding and ensure bedrooms remain tidy and comfortable.
- ·Dispose of household waste and recycling appropriately.
- ·Keep walkways and living spaces free from clutter and potential trip hazards.
- ·Promptly clean spills and monitor floor safety.
- ·Identify and report maintenance or safety concerns within the home.
- ·Support clients by ensuring frequently used items remain easily accessible.
- ·Provide basic meal support including light food preparation and meal set-up where required.
- ·Assist with kitchen clean-up and maintaining hygienic food storage areas.
- ·Help organise cupboards, pantries, and refrigerators while monitoring food freshness and expiry dates.
- ·Encourage our clients to participate in tasks and work in accordance with organisational policies, workplace procedures, and Aged Care, NDIS & DVA Quality Standards.
- ·Follow infection prevention, manual handling, and workplace health and safety requirements which includes using cleaning equipment and products responsibly and safely.
Essential Criteria when applying for the position:
- ·Right to Work in Australia – A valid VISA is required to work in Australia, and this must be current.
- ·NDIS Screen Check – this document must be cited prior to starting with Focused Care.
- ·NDIS Orientation Module – this module must be completed within 7 days from the start date of employment.
- ·Suitable vehicle – a vehicle that is roadworthy and has comprehensive car insurance should be in place prior to start date. The vehicle must have the capacity to transport
multiple passengers (minimum 1 passenger) in a safe and comfortable manner.
- ·Driver’s License – a valid Australian Driver’s License (preferred) or International License must be supplied prior to start date.
- ·Full COVID and Flu Vaccinations Certificate – a copy of this document must be supplied prior to start date.
- ·Current CPR Certificate – a copy of this document must be supplied prior to start date.
- ·Working with Children Check (WWCC) – a valid WWCC must be supplied prior to start date or alternatively, it must be cited within 1 week from the start date of employment.
- ·Current Manual Handling – this document must be supplied before start date.
- ·100 Points of ID – evidence must be supplied prior to start date.
- ·National Police Clearance Certificate – supplied and current (maximum of 6 months old) prior to start date.
